Microsoft reverses Xbox Live price hike, will add free multiplayer for some games – Yahoo Finance Australia
Microsoft won’t raise the price of Xbox Live, and it’s adding free multiplayer for free-to-play games like ‘Fortnite.’

In one of the first positive Friday night news dumps I can remember, Microsoft has not only reversed course on its poorly-received plan to raise the price for Xbox Live, its adding a treat. Soon, for free-to-play games (like Fortnite or Apex Legends), multiplayer access will be free, making the Xbox a much more attractive platform for gamers on a budget. Playing a game like Fortnite on PlayStation Network or PC has always been free, and now Xbox Live will handle things the same way.
